Application of the Weyl calculus perspective on discrete octonionic analysis in bounded domains
Abstract
In this paper, we finish the basic development of the discrete octonionic analysis by presenting a Weyl calculus-based approach to bounded domains in $\mathbb{R}^{8}$. In particular, we explicitly prove the discrete Stokes formula for a bounded cuboid, and then we generalise this result to arbitrary bounded domains in interior and exterior settings by the help of characteristic functions. After that, discrete interior and exterior Borel-Pompeiu and Cauchy formulae are introduced. Finally, we recall the construction of discrete octonionic Hardy spaces for bounded domains. Moreover, we explicitly explain where the non-associativity of octonionic multiplication is essential and where it is not. Thus, this paper completes the basic framework of the discrete octonionic analysis introduced in previous papers, and, hence, provides a solid foundation for further studies in this field.
